Deprecated API


Contents
Deprecated Classes
org.eclipse.xtext.ui.generator.BasicUiGeneratorFragment
           
org.eclipse.xtext.ui.codetemplates.generator.CodetemplatesGeneratorFragment
          use CodetemplatesGeneratorFragment instead. 
org.eclipse.xtext.builder.EclipseResourceFileSystemAccess
          use EclipseResourceFileSystemAccess2 instead 
org.eclipse.xtext.builder.JavaProjectBasedBuilderParticipant
          use BuilderParticipant instead 
org.eclipse.xtext.xbase.ui.jvmmodel.refactoring.jdt.JDTRenamePartcipant
          JDT refactoring participation is now handled centrally by the JdtRenameParticipant 
org.eclipse.xtext.xbase.jvmmodel.JvmVisibilityExtension
          as Xtend supports enum literals now 
org.eclipse.xtext.ui.editor.model.ResourceAwareXtextDocumentProvider
           
org.eclipse.xtext.parsetree.reconstr.SerializerOptions
          use the immutable SaveOptions instead. 
org.eclipse.xtext.generator.grammarAccess.SubPackageAwareGrammarAccessFragment
           
org.eclipse.xtext.ui.editor.tasks.TaskTagsMarkerListener
          Unused and will be removed in a future Xtext versions 
 

Deprecated Fields
org.eclipse.xtext.resource.XtextResource.OPTION_FORMAT
          use SaveOptions#configure(Map) instead. 
org.eclipse.xtext.resource.XtextResource.OPTION_SERIALIZATION_OPTIONS
          use SaveOptions#configure(Map) instead. 
org.eclipse.xtext.diagnostics.Diagnostic.SYNTAX_DIAGNOSITC
          use Diagnostic.SYNTAX_DIAGNOSTIC instead. 
org.eclipse.xtext.formatting.impl.FormattingConfig.whitespaceRule
           
 

Deprecated Methods
org.eclipse.xtext.generator.Naming.activator()
          use Naming.activatorName() instead 
org.eclipse.xtext.generator.ecore.EcoreGeneratorFragment.addSaveMapping(Mapping)
          Save mappings are no longer supported. The EcoreGeneratorFragment will use the uri that is given in the referenced genmodel or create a platform resource uri for new files. 
org.eclipse.xtext.ui.wizard.AbstractProjectCreator.configureProjectBuilder(ProjectFactory)
          use AbstractProjectCreator.configureProjectFactory(ProjectFactory) instead. 
org.eclipse.xtext.ui.editor.hover.AbstractCompositeHover.getHoverInfo(ITextViewer, IRegion)
           
org.eclipse.xtext.ui.editor.hover.AbstractHover.getHoverInfo(ITextViewer, IRegion)
          Use ITextHoverExtension2.getHoverInfo2(ITextViewer, IRegion) instead 
org.eclipse.xtext.ui.editor.hover.DispatchingEObjectTextHover.getHoverInfo(ITextViewer, IRegion)
           
org.eclipse.xtext.ui.editor.validation.AddMarkersOperation.getMarkerId()
          use AddMarkersOperation.getMarkerIds() instead. 
org.eclipse.xtext.xbase.conversion.StaticQualifierValueConverter.getNamespaceDelimiter()
           
org.eclipse.xtext.conversion.impl.QualifiedNameValueConverter.getNamespaceDelimiter()
          use QualifiedNameValueConverter.getStringNamespaceDelimiter() or QualifiedNameValueConverter.getValueNamespaceDelimiter(). 
org.eclipse.xtext.builder.builderState.impl.BuilderStateFactoryImpl.getPackage()
            
org.eclipse.xtext.common.types.impl.TypesFactoryImpl.getPackage()
            
org.eclipse.xtext.generator.parser.antlr.debug.simpleAntlr.impl.SimpleAntlrFactoryImpl.getPackage()
            
org.eclipse.xtext.generator.parser.antlr.splitting.simpleExpressions.impl.SimpleExpressionsFactoryImpl.getPackage()
            
org.eclipse.xtext.purexbase.pureXbase.impl.PureXbaseFactoryImpl.getPackage()
            
org.eclipse.xtext.ui.codetemplates.templates.impl.TemplatesFactoryImpl.getPackage()
            
org.eclipse.xtext.xbase.annotations.xAnnotations.impl.XAnnotationsFactoryImpl.getPackage()
            
org.eclipse.xtext.xbase.impl.XbaseFactoryImpl.getPackage()
            
org.eclipse.xtext.xtype.impl.XtypeFactoryImpl.getPackage()
            
org.eclipse.xtext.xtend2.richstring.impl.ProcessedRichStringFactoryImpl.getPackage()
            
org.eclipse.xtext.xtend2.xtend2.impl.Xtend2FactoryImpl.getPackage()
            
org.eclipse.xtext.impl.XtextFactoryImpl.getPackage()
            
org.eclipse.xtext.ui.editor.hyperlinking.HyperlinkHelper.getParentNodeWithCrossReference(INode)
          use EObjectAtOffsetHelper.getCrossReferenceNode(XtextResource, org.eclipse.xtext.util.ITextRegion) 
org.eclipse.xtext.generator.ecore.EcoreGeneratorFragment.getReferencedGenModels()
           
org.eclipse.xtext.ui.resource.DefaultResourceUIServiceProvider.getReferenceUpdater()
          use get(IReferenceUpdater.class) instead 
org.eclipse.xtext.ui.resource.IResourceUIServiceProvider.getReferenceUpdater()
          use get(IReferenceUpdater.class) instead 
org.eclipse.xtext.formatting.impl.FormattingConfig.getWhitespaceRule()
           
org.eclipse.xtext.parsetree.reconstr.IHiddenTokenHelper.getWhitespaceRuleFor(String)
           
org.eclipse.xtext.common.types.xtext.ui.IntersectingJavaSearchScope.includesBinaries()
           
org.eclipse.xtext.common.types.xtext.ui.IntersectingJavaSearchScope.includesClasspaths()
           
org.eclipse.xtext.generator.ecore.EcoreGeneratorFragment.loadReferencedGenModels(ResourceSet)
           
org.eclipse.xtext.resource.generic.AbstractGenericResourceSupport.registerInRegistry()
          use AbstractGenericResourceSupport.registerInRegistry(boolean) instead. 
org.eclipse.xtext.generator.ecore.EcoreGeneratorFragment.registerReferencedGenModels()
           
org.eclipse.xtext.ui.codetemplates.ui.contentassist.DummyDocument.search(int, String, boolean, boolean, boolean)
           
org.eclipse.xtext.parsetree.reconstr.Serializer.serialize(EObject, ITokenStream, SerializerOptions)
           
org.eclipse.xtext.parsetree.reconstr.Serializer.serialize(EObject, SerializerOptions)
           
org.eclipse.xtext.parsetree.reconstr.Serializer.serialize(EObject, Writer, SerializerOptions)
           
org.eclipse.xtext.ui.codetemplates.ui.contentassist.DummyTextViewer.setAutoIndentStrategy(IAutoIndentStrategy, String)
           
org.eclipse.xtext.generator.ecore.EcoreGeneratorFragment.setGenModels(String)
            
org.eclipse.xtext.formatting.impl.AbstractDeclarativeFormatter.setGrammarAccess(IGrammarAccess)
           
org.eclipse.xtext.util.OnChangeEvictingCache.CacheAdapter.setIgnoreNotifications(boolean)
          use OnChangeEvictingCache.CacheAdapter.ignoreNotifications() and OnChangeEvictingCache.CacheAdapter.listenToNotifications() instead. 
org.eclipse.xtext.common.types.xtext.ui.IntersectingJavaSearchScope.setIncludesBinaries(boolean)
           
org.eclipse.xtext.common.types.xtext.ui.IntersectingJavaSearchScope.setIncludesClasspaths(boolean)
           
org.eclipse.xtext.generator.ecore.EcoreGeneratorFragment.setReferencedGenModels(String)
           
org.eclipse.xtext.ui.editor.model.edit.DefaultTextEditComposer.setSerializerUtil(ISerializer)
          use DefaultTextEditComposer.setSerializer(ISerializer) instead. 
org.eclipse.xtext.ui.editor.tasks.dialogfields.ListDialogField.setViewerSorter(ViewerSorter)
          Use ListDialogField.setViewerComparator(ViewerComparator) instead} 
org.eclipse.xtext.formatting.impl.FormattingConfig.setWhitespaceRule(TerminalRule)
           
 

Deprecated Constructors
org.eclipse.xtext.ui.editor.validation.AddMarkersOperation(IResource, List, String, boolean, MarkerCreator)